According to famed author and educator Peter Drucker, entrepreneurship is crucial for economic development. What does it mean, then, to live in a society that is becoming more entrepreneurial?There are six major signs that you live in an entrepreneurial society:1. Innovation precedes regulation: The regulators eventually catch up, but not before the innovators have developed viable solutions for us to improve our lives.2. Entrepreneurs and innovators are richly rewarded for their breakthroughs: In an entrepreneurial society, entrepreneurs are popular heroes and profit materially from their work.3. The government depends on the ingenuity of the innovators: A society’s ability to develop innovations that continually solve problems is the best index to its long-term growth and prosperity. A government must manage the economy in order to promote innovation and entrepreneurship in order to remain competitive and vibrant.4.
